I worked on migrating our MySQL system to PostgreSQL using pgloader ( https://pgloader.io/ ). There were some hiccups, things that needed clarification in documentation, and some additional processes that needed to be done outside of the system to get everything we need in place, it was a amazing help. Not sure the project would've been possible without it. Data mapping from PostgreSQL to PostgreSQL as in the... - Source: Hacker News / over 2 years ago
Initially, I started down the pgloader path, which seemed to be a common approach for the database conversion. However, using my M1-chip MacBook Pro led to some unexpected issues. Instead, I opted to use NMIG to convert MySQL to PostgreSQL. For more information, please check out the โHighlights From the Database Conversionโ section below. - Source: dev.to / over 3 years ago
